Hershey Entertainment Complex facts for kids
The Hershey Entertainment Complex is a huge area in Derry Township, Pennsylvania. It's home to many fun places like Hersheypark, Hersheypark Stadium, Star Pavilion, Hersheypark Arena, and the Giant Center.
This whole complex is owned by the Hershey Entertainment and Resorts Company (HE&R). They are based right in Hershey, Pennsylvania.

Hersheypark Stadium: Sports and Concerts
The Hersheypark Stadium is a large outdoor area. It has concrete seats on two sides. This stadium can hold 15,000 people for sports like football and soccer. For concerts, it can fit over 30,000 fans.
The stadium hosts the Summer Concert Series. It's also where the Big 33 Football Classic takes place. You can also watch the PIAA Football and Soccer Championships here. Many local events happen at the stadium too.
Star Pavilion: Smaller Concerts
The Star Pavilion is located at the north end of Hersheypark Stadium. It's a place for smaller concerts. Up to 7,500 people can enjoy shows here. Some seats are reserved, and some are general admission on the grass.
Hersheypark Arena: A Historic Ice Rink
Hersheypark Arena is one of the oldest ice rinks still standing in the United States. It was built in 1939 for the Hershey Bears hockey team. Over the years, it got older, which led to building the Giant Center.
The arena used to host ice hockey games and big shows. These included the Ringling Brothers Barnum and Bailey Circus and WWE Wrestling. It also held small concerts for about 7,000 people. Today, it's used for local hockey practice and youth games. You can also go public skating or attend meetings here. This is also where Wilt Chamberlain scored 100 points in one NBA game.
Giant Center: Central Pennsylvania's Main Arena
The Giant Center is a top indoor arena in central Pennsylvania. It is located at 950 W. Hersheypark Drive. This arena was built in 2002. It replaced the older Hersheypark Arena, which was getting old and too small.
The GIANT Center is the biggest arena in South Central Pennsylvania. The Township of Derry owns this large and modern facility.
Emergency Preparedness: Staying Safe
The Hershey Entertainment Complex is ready for severe weather. In March 2008, it earned the StormReady certification. The National Weather Service gives this award to places prepared for bad weather.
The complex has special emergency plans. These include ways to act during emergencies and evacuation plans. They also have places for people to go for shelter. The complex uses many security cameras. There are also trained security staff. They have systems to spot and detect weather changes. All these efforts help keep everyone safe.
